It's playoff time, and Springville had no trouble coming through when it counted. They walked away with a 2-0 victory over the Timpview Thunderbirds on Thursday. That's the third time they've managed to beat them this season, with their most recent win being a 3-1 victory two weeks ago.
Sage Conrad was the driving force of Springville's attack as she scored both of Springville's goals, bringing her season total up to 18 goals.

The win was the sixth in a row for Springville, bringing their record up to 15-5. Those victories came thanks in part to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they scored 18 goals over those six matches. As for Timpview, they have been struggling recently as they've lost three of their last four contests. That's put a noticeable dent in their 14-6 record this season.
Springville didn't take long to hit the pitch again: they've already played their next matchup, a 3-2 loss against Bountiful on the 21st. Timpview does not have any more games scheduled as of now.
